If someone is in danger

In the US, call or text 988 for the Suicide & Crisis Lifeline, or 911 if someone is in danger right now. KNOWN. is not an emergency service.

Working alongside professionals

Pastoral care can work alongside licensed counselors, physicians, schools, and other professionals when additional support is appropriate. We keep a referral list and will help you find a good fit.
